The Art of Doing - Python Network Applications with Sockets - Online Multiplayer Game Part 6 - Starting the Game on the

The Art of Doing - Python Network Applications with Sockets - Online Multiplayer Game Part 6 - Starting the Game on the

Assessment

Interactive Video

Information Technology (IT), Architecture

University

Hard

Created by

Quizizz Content

FREE Resource

The video tutorial covers setting up a multiplayer game server, handling player connections, and managing game states through key press events. It explains how to update player status and communicate these changes to the server using JSON. The tutorial also demonstrates implementing threading on the server to handle player readiness and concludes with testing and debugging the setup.

Read more

10 questions

Show all answers

1.

OPEN ENDED QUESTION

3 mins • 1 pt

What is the initial step that occurs when various clients connect to the server?

Evaluate responses using AI:

OFF

2.

OPEN ENDED QUESTION

3 mins • 1 pt

Describe the process that occurs when a new player joins the game.

Evaluate responses using AI:

OFF

3.

OPEN ENDED QUESTION

3 mins • 1 pt

What signal do clients send to indicate they are ready to play?

Evaluate responses using AI:

OFF

4.

OPEN ENDED QUESTION

3 mins • 1 pt

Explain the role of the main game loop in handling Pygame events.

Evaluate responses using AI:

OFF

5.

OPEN ENDED QUESTION

3 mins • 1 pt

What checks must be performed before advancing to the next game state?

Evaluate responses using AI:

OFF

6.

OPEN ENDED QUESTION

3 mins • 1 pt

What method is called to update the player's status when they are ready?

Evaluate responses using AI:

OFF

7.

OPEN ENDED QUESTION

3 mins • 1 pt

Describe the process of sending player information to the server.

Evaluate responses using AI:

OFF

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?